First registered in August
1927, this charming Austin Seven Tourer is powered by the iconic 747cc engine
and is offered with just two former keepers recorded on the current V5C. The
current vendor has cherished the car since March 1997, highlighting nearly three
decades of long-term ownership.
Presented in attractive blue
and black coachwork with a matching black leatherette interior, the colour was
officially changed from its original red and black in December 1996. A true
veteran of the pre-war motoring scene, the Austin starts, runs and drives,
allowing its next owner to enjoy one of Britain's most influential light
cars.
Accompanying the car is an
appealing history file including both an old-style log book and a desirable Buff
Log Book, together with three previous MOT certificates and a selection of
invoices documenting maintenance and work carried out over the years. An ideal
entrant into vintage motoring, this delightful Austin Seven Tourer offers
simple, enjoyable driving and would make a welcome addition to any collection or
vintage rally.
